SUICIDE as a Way Out?

Suicide as a Way Out
At any age or stage of life people are committing suicide. Why? What reasons are that strong? How can one even consider such a huge opt out?

As a young mother of three children and another on the way I reached a point of despair. The work load was too great and the finances too small. I was prolific and birth control measures were not effective.A young teen in our community had just been successful at taking his own life that was pre planned, journalled and laid out in his art work. In my desperate state of mind I reasoned that if he could do it so could I.As I contemplated on how and when and taking my kids with me, I heard an voice that reminded me that I was not my own but His.

I replied to Him that if He wanted this life He was welcome to it as I was so unable to cope anymore. I gave up my rights to myself again and put myself and my children into His hand of love and mercy and grace.I was spared the shame of opting out of this arena and our families were spared the awful grief, accusations and guilt that follows them for the rest of their lives.

Because I believe in God the Heavenly Father, the Great Jehovah and His Son Jesus Christ, and Holy Spirit I was saved from self destruction. Without them I would have caved in to the exit. If the Father of all living had not spoken to me at that precise moment the hell I would have encountered whether I lived or died would have ruined me forever.
Being old and full of days I have since heard of and seen many families destroyed because of a member of their clan or a friend feeling that life was not worth living anymore and so going through death's door into eternity. Troubled souls abound in our time in every country on the face of the earth. Only the realization of God's capable ways can save any of us.

Knowing that the Lord of all is on our side and wanting to deliver us from fear and our inabilities we can go on daily expecting Him to intervene for us. As I gave up to Jesus my future He sent a lady that knew my husband to visit me. When she saw that my house was a terrible mess and I was looking pale and tired she went into action and faithfully came weekly to my aid. She even went to my husbands boss and explained that my husband needed to take some time for us and go on a holiday.Jesus overdelivers all the time. This dear lady asked for nothing and gave us clothing for our kids. Her husband lent us money to buy a car paying it back one hundred dollars a month. Her only suggestion was to pass on the favors when we were able to some other needy family, which we have done several times already and will continue to do.
